结论先行:2GB内存的Ubuntu系统服务器仅适用于轻量级任务,如个人学习或小型静态网站,但无法满足高并发或复杂应用的需求。
1. 内存需求与系统负载
Ubuntu系统本身在无额外服务运行时,内存占用约为500MB-1GB。如果仅用于基础操作(如SSH连接、文件管理),2GB内存可以满足需求。然而,一旦运行Web服务器(如Apache或Nginx)、数据库(如MySQL)或其他应用,内存消耗会迅速增加,导致系统性能下降。
2. 应用场景分析
- 轻量级任务:个人学习、开发测试、小型静态网站等场景,2GB内存足够。
- 高并发或复杂应用:如运行多用户Web应用、大数据处理或虚拟机,2GB内存将严重不足,建议至少4GB或以上。
3. 优化与替代方案
若必须使用2GB内存服务器,可通过以下方式优化:
- 精简系统:使用Server版Ubuntu,关闭非必要服务。
- 资源管理:配置Swap分区,缓解内存不足问题。
- 替代方案:考虑升级内存或使用云服务器,按需扩展资源。
总结:2GB内存的Ubuntu服务器仅适合轻量级任务,对于高负载场景,建议升级硬件或选择更高效的资源配置。
CCLOUD博客